Are you a Multiskilled Engineer with strong fabrication and welding skills looking for a varied days-based role? Join a leading manufacturing business in Winsford where you'll play a vital role in maintaining, repairing and improving a diverse range of production machinery and site equipment. Working within an established engineering team, you'll combine your maintenance expertise with fabrication skills to support operational performance, equipment reliability and continuous improvement across the site.

What You'll Be Doing

  • Drive Maintenance Excellence: Carry out planned preventative maintenance to maximise equipment reliability and minimise downtime.
  • Solve Engineering Problems: Diagnose and repair machine faults across the site, delivering effective solutions quickly and safely.
  • Lead Fabrication Activities: Complete a range of fabrication work to support maintenance, plant improvements and operational requirements.
  • Support Engineering Projects: Assist with machinery installations, upgrades and site improvement initiatives.
  • Promote Safe Working: Ensure all equipment remains compliant with health, safety and legal requirements.
  • Collaborate Across Departments: Work closely with stores personnel, contractors and colleagues across the business to keep operations running smoothly.
  • Drive Continuous Improvement: Identify opportunities to improve equipment performance, reliability and efficiency.
  • Maintain Accurate Records: Complete maintenance and breakdown documentation in line with company procedures.

What We're Looking For

  • Qualified Engineer: Apprentice trained, ONC qualified or holding an equivalent Multiskilled or Fabrication Engineering qualification.
  • Maintenance Experience: Experience carrying out planned preventative maintenance and reactive maintenance activities within a manufacturing environment.
  • Fabrication Expertise: Strong practical experience in MIG, TIG and Stick welding.
  • Strong Fault-Finding Skills: Proven maintenance background with the ability to diagnose and resolve engineering issues effectively.
  • Manufacturing Background: Previous experience working within an industrial or manufacturing environment.
  • Strong Communicator: Able to build effective working relationships across all levels of the business.
  • Positive Team Player: Flexible, proactive and enthusiastic approach with a willingness to learn and adapt.
